Hawaii — Wednesday, September 1, 2010

Zillow Mortgage Marketplace reports Hawaii mortgage rates for 30-year fixed-rate mortgages dropped 1 basis points from 4.18% to 4.17% on Wednesday. State mortgage rates ranged from the lowest rate of 4.15% (UT) to the highest rate of 4.41% (DC). Currently, Hawaii mortgage rates are 6 basis points lower than the national average of 4.23%.

The Hawaii mortgage rate on September 1, 2010, is down 5 basis points from last week's average Hawaii rate of 4.22%.
